Good Genes Hypothesis

A theory in evolutionary biology suggesting that individuals with favorable genetic traits are more attractive to the opposite sex because those traits are associated with better health or greater survivability.

Opportunity for Selection

The potential for natural selection to act on a population, often quantified by the variance in reproductive success among individuals.
